Mark moved his family from Salisbury, Maryland to southwestern Suffolk, Virginia in 1999 and Pecan Hill Farm was born. An awesome daughter and three amazing sons grew up on the family farm raising sheep, goats, cattle and a few pigs. The kids were active in 4-H and FFA and showed livestock at county, state and national shows. In 2007, Mark married Debbie, she and two incredible sons moved to the farm, and a countrified version of the “Brady Bunch” was completed! The family grew with the addition of an extraordinary son-in-law and four (soon to be five!) wonderful daughters-in-law. Debbie and I have also been blessed to have a new crop of shepherds that includes seven (soon to be eight!) grandsons and two (soon to be four!) granddaughters.
Over the years our family has grown, all our lives have changed, and the kids have moved off the farm. One thing has remained constant, we strive to produce healthy, high-quality livestock to be sold at reasonable prices. We are proud members of the Virginia Sheep and Pork Industries!
